@JCPlantProper spotted it earlyβ€”after doing some research, I’ve determined that this is indeed NOT a Gloriosum. The petiole isn’t D-shaped like a Gloriosum, and this appears to be climbing as opposed to self-heading.

I can’t tell what it is! Maybe P. Glorious? Or P. Splendid? I feel VERY confident that it is not a P. Melochrysum. Any ideas? TIA!
